What is the Sunday Reset Routine?
The Sunday Reset Routine is a weekly practice that involves dedicating 20 minutes to reflecting on your past week, planning for the upcoming one, and setting intentions for personal growth. This routine helps you:
- Reflect: Evaluate your accomplishments, challenges, and areas for improvement from the previous week.
- Plan: Set clear goals, prioritize tasks, and create a schedule for the upcoming week.
- Intend: Identify opportunities for self-care, learning, and personal development.
The 20-Minute Sunday Reset Routine:
- Minutes 1-5: Take a few minutes to relax and unwind. Light some candles, put on calming music, or practice deep breathing exercises.
-
Minutes 6-10: Reflect on your past week:
- What did you accomplish?
- What challenges did you face?
- What would you do differently next time?
- Write down any insights or lessons learned in a journal.
-
Minutes 11-15: Plan for the upcoming week:
- Review your schedule and prioritize tasks.
- Set clear goals for each day of the week.
- Break down large tasks into smaller, manageable chunks.
-
Minutes 16-20: Intend for personal growth and self-care:
- Identify areas where you'd like to improve or learn more.
- Plan self-care activities, such as exercise, meditation, or reading.
- Write down any intentions or affirmations to help guide your week.
Make it a Habit:
To make this routine stick, commit to doing it every Sunday at the same time. Try to maintain consistency, even if you miss a week here and there. Remember, the goal is to develop habits that support your well-being and productivity.
Additional Tips:
- Use a planner or app to stay organized and on track.
- Review and adjust your routine regularly to ensure it continues to serve you.
- Be gentle with yourself when reflecting on past challenges – focus on what you can learn from them rather than dwelling on mistakes.
- Prioritize self-care activities, such as exercise, meditation, or spending time in nature.
